Between Wynonna, Ashley, and their mother Naomi, the Judd family clearly has talent when it comes singing and acting. But how are they in the kitchen? "Ashley's the baker, I'm the carb queen," Wynonna explains. "My mom's the casserole queen. We call her meals the 'butt-extender meals.' My mother loves casseroles -- anything with cream of chicken or cream of mushroom soup. We came from welfare and so we didn't have a lot of meats so we made a lot of casseroles."
Joking about her family, Wynonna says, "There's a lot of creativity. We're very dysfunctional, but my mother said 'Normal is just a cycle on the washing machine.' I love that. That's so true!"
